Understanding and Preventing Sentinel Events in Your Health Care Organization

By Editor


Product Description
Since 1 January 2008, Joint Commission International’s (JCI’s) Sentinel Event Policy has been enforced for its accredited hospitals. This book will help readers understand the policy and its ramifications, including the following: the sentinel event, as defined by JCI; how sentinel events may be prevented; how sentinel events should be reported; what organizations can learn from sentinel events and their aftermath; how to define sentinel events in your organization; and, how to create a Sentinel Event Policy. Detailed information on sentinel event-related topics such as the following are offered: types of sentinel events; Joint Commission International’s Sentinel Event Policy; root causes of sentinel events; strategies for preventing sentinel events; developing a root cause analysis; and, ethics, disclosure, and legal consequences of medical errors.
